1 more results for cheap storage in Toronto, Ontario
Toronto, Ontario, Canada
We are a self storage facility, renting units on a month by month basis to customers who require temporary or permanent space. Our facilities advantages include the fact it is climate controlled, has individually alarmed units, 24/7 access and virtually brand new.Our sizes vary from 5x5 to 10x20 and…